Transaction 8836decee203cbe3242d16dd3a5d9c8889e0fc96db2bc0a4cd527298e7bdcb8b
1 Input
1 Output
-
8836decee203cbe3242d16dd3a5d9c8889e0fc96db2bc0a4cd527298e7bdcb8b:0
- value
- 90652018
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d4eebfe1692cc133462cd83a2d66cb2558f8ab0
- address
- bc1qe48whlskjtxpxdrzekp694nvkf2clz4smwlq54